Warning: Last I heard Gamestop was going to stop customers from using GS Giftcards to purchase digital currency like Xbox Live GCs, Steam GCs, Roblox, etc.

I dropped GS's Pro membership when they stopped allowing customers to redeem the monthly rewards on game currency, so it was announced, but I have not tracked if they implemented it.

If you're planning on using the GS GC on something like a video game, Funko Pop, etc, I think you're fine, but if not (or you plan on giving as a gift) make sure you investigate that before purchasing.
